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23 91 85612240 299033669
1984733248 1685796687
1984733248 1685796687
5228 923 6412 19
All about undefined
Interested in learning more?
1984733248 1685796687
5228 923 6412 19
See more
98308538 9728639919 8653516726
715484488 473424 69702 376269422 5460106292
See more
68 41557441097
3744151 327301803 6250
See more